Loyalty programmes shoud seek to find ways of adding value to enhance the customer experience. Value may, but need not be financial. Often the most prized value received lies in non-financial benefits. Gallup states that less than a third of B2B customers are actively engaged with companies that they do business with. This means that over two thirds have no relationships with their suppliers and are thus easily persuded to switch suppliers. In fact, a good word from a friend or colleague may be all it takes to see the customer switch suppliers.
The key is to ensure that customers realise the value in their relationship with a supplier. When they do they will, if they are provided with value and a simple an convenient channel to to do so. Not only will this ensure that suppliers retain customers but it will ensure that returning customers are joined by their friends and business associates. Value could be found in the following:
